Transaction 59680f91bf925fdc9aab9368b4db8a1059aa7522359fa63dca9062c9c392f0e3
1 Input
1 Output
-
59680f91bf925fdc9aab9368b4db8a1059aa7522359fa63dca9062c9c392f0e3:0
- value
- 841486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e009143a2325a1a92403ef541618d743f188aecc OP_EQUAL
- address
- 3N7cALMomRfRApB3YEF6qjYeQckPXAVhQs